Holiday Shipping Volumes: An Update

This year has had its hurdles but we remain committed to keeping your crafty juices flowing!

Retailers saw record setting growth in their online sales in 2020 and the increase in holiday volume has pushed carriers past their breaking point. Covid-19 has exacerbated this problem as carriers scramble to maintain a full and healthy workforce. Shipping delays are commonplace both here in the USA and abroad. Our shipping partners are no exception. With the increased rate of online orders needing to be shipped to their forever homes, our carriers are being inundated with packages to deliver and this has resulted in transit delays and delayed visibility by way of online tracking.

Our warehouse itself is not experiencing any delays and our pick, pack and ship operation is currently on schedule. Rest assured, we are doing everything we can on our end to ensure your orders arrive in a timely manner. We apologize for any inconvenience you may experience while waiting for the arrival of your crafty goodies. Thank you for your patience and loyalty.
